How do you keep hope when the forces of destruction rain about you?
That is the question contemplated by the Eisen family for generations. A small band of halflings living in Kenabres, they are no stranger to the unending war against the demons of the Worldwound. Although there have been stalwart halflings battling at the front lines throughout history, the Eisens were content to remain at home in the city, tending and serving the crusaders who returned from the field of battle. There were many crusaders, they would explain, but someone must keep the hearth lit at home, for else what was there to fight for?
Bellis spent her childhood in much the same way, providing soothing music to invalid knights, always eager to hear stories from the battles, showing those who willingly fought such a fell enemy that their sacrifice is not in vain. She thought that her future would remain such an existence, in service to the fighters, but never one, herself.
That changed the day the fight came to Kenabres.
Crashing through the barrier of the wardstone, the fall of the dragon rendered the entire city in chaos. Bellis realized that staying away from the battle was not her fate, and she ran forth to immediately help with the rescue and rebuild. She has experienced the horrors in town, and with her fiddle by her side, she no longer dare sit back.
She will no longer tend with hope those who fall back. Now, she will bring the hope to the battle.
Appearance
Bellis normally performs with a fiddle, and is trained in dance. As a result, she is lithe, graceful, with slender fingers. Although she has taken to wearing a chain shirt for protection, she makes sure it is of the lightest material possible, and pairs it--perhaps incongruously--with a short skirt that flares like a tutu. She avoids wearing anything with bulk on her legs, all the better to dance and move about.
Her hair is a dark brown, long, straight, and usually held back with a ribbon or headband. Her eyes are very large, a similar brown, with flecks of blue closer to her pupils.
